Which of the following statements about enzymes is wrong?

Options

(a) Enzymes require optimum pH and temperature for maximum activity
(b) Enzymes are denatured at high temperatures
(c) Enzymes are mostly proteins but some are lipids also
(d) Enzymes are highly specific

Correct Answer:

Enzymes are mostly proteins but some are lipids also

Explanation:

Almost all enzymes are proteins. There are some nucleic acids that behave like enzymes. There are called ribozyme (also called RNA enzyme or catalytic RNA).
